1. Use of Secure Platforms

The platform used to carry out the deal ought to have robust security procedures in place. This includes safe and secure socket layer (SSL) encryption, which protects information sent in between the user and the site.

ComponentDescriptionSSL EncryptionGuarantees that all information transferred is encrypted.Protect PaymentUsage trusted payment entrances for processing costs.Verified SourcesMake sure that the website is formally connected with PTE.

2. Multi-Factor Authentication

Implementing multi-factor authentication (MFA) includes an additional layer of security. This requires users to provide 2 or more verification elements to get to their accounts.

Authentication MethodDescriptionSMS VerificationA code sent out to the user's registered mobile number.Email VerificationA verification link sent to the user's signed up email.Biometric AuthenticationUsage of finger print or facial acknowledgment.

3. Strong Password Policies

Motivating strong password practices is necessary for protected deals. Passwords ought to be intricate, regularly upgraded, and never ever shared.

Password Best PracticesDescriptionLengthA minimum of 12 characters is suggested.ComplexityUse a mix of letters, numbers, and signs.Regular UpdatesChange passwords every three months.
